Abbott’s Bakery Dark Rye is a softer twist on classic rye bread, with deep, malty flavours and an earthy finish. Baked with rye flour and topped with a sprinkle of semolina for gentle crunch, this Bakery Bread loaf is perfect for Reuben sandwiches or any topping you love. Made with Australian wheat, it’s a source of fibre, provides 7.3 g of protein per serving and contains no artificial colours, flavours or preservatives. This is delicious bread and a good inclusion in the Abbots range. I’ve had light rye bread before but love the dark rye and was pleased to find it instore recently. It has a 4-star health rating. I did expect a larger quantity of rye and was surprised that rye flour is only 11% and rye meal 4.5%. Contains barley, rye, wheat, gluten and soy as possible allergens. says also my be present - oats and sesame. suitable do vegetarians and vegans. All in all a delicious bread alternative.

Abbott's Bakery Dark Rye has become a staple in my kitchen. The bread boasts a deep, malty flavor that's both rich and satisfying. Its soft texture, combined with a gentle crunch from the semolina topping, makes it versatile for various meals. What I appreciate: Flavor Profile: The earthy taste of rye flour is prominent without being overpowering. Texture: Soft and moist, yet holds up well when toasted or used in sandwiches. Nutritional Value: With 7.3g of protein per serve and being a source of fiber, it aligns well with my dietary preferences. Dietary Considerations: It's suitable for vegetarians and vegans, and it's Halal certified, which broadens its appeal. Considerations: Availability: While it's available in major supermarkets like Coles and Woolworths, I've noticed it can sometimes be out of stock, so I tend to buy an extra loaf when I can. Shelf Life: As with many breads without preservatives, it has a shorter shelf life. I often freeze slices to extend its usability.
